Web25 mrt. 2015 · you take the dilution factor into account when calculating the final protein concentration that your readings still fall within the linear range of the assay Use the matrix to calibrate Dilute your standards and your samples in sample matrix. For example, you could dilute both in normal serum. This can be solved by Grover's algorithm using O ( n ) {\displaystyle O({\sqrt {n}})} queries to the database, quadratically fewer than the Ω ( n ) {\displaystyle \Omega (n)} … coast guard asvab score minWebLipemia is a turbidity of the sample caused by accumulation of lipoprotein particles. As lipoproteins vary in sizes, not all classes contribute equally to the turbidity. The largest particles, chylomicrons, with sample size of 70-1000 nm, have the greatest potential in causing turbidity of the sample. coast guard auction website
